在软件开发的海洋中,编码是每一位程序员必备的技能。然而,随着项目的复杂度不断提升,编码难题也接踵而至。RSC编码,作为一种新兴的编码技术,正逐渐成为解决这些难题的利器。本文将带您深入了解RSC编码,探讨它是如何让软件开发更高效,以及如何轻松应对编码难题。
RSC编码:什么是它?
RSC编码,全称为“Resource Sharing Code”,即资源共享编码。它是一种基于资源共享思想的编码方式,旨在通过优化资源分配和利用,提高编码效率和降低开发成本。
与传统编码方式相比,RSC编码具有以下特点:
- 资源共享:RSC编码强调资源(如代码、库、工具等)的共享,避免重复开发,提高开发效率。
- 模块化:RSC编码将代码分解为多个模块,便于管理和维护。
- 可复用性:RSC编码强调代码的可复用性,降低开发成本。
- 灵活性:RSC编码支持多种编程语言和框架,适应不同项目需求。
RSC编码如何让软件开发更高效?
- 降低开发成本:通过资源共享,RSC编码减少了重复开发的工作量,降低了开发成本。
- 提高开发效率:模块化和可复用性使得开发人员可以快速构建项目,提高开发效率。
- 提升代码质量:RSC编码强调代码规范和可维护性,有助于提升代码质量。
- 适应性强:RSC编码支持多种编程语言和框架,适应不同项目需求。
RSC编码实战案例
以下是一个使用RSC编码解决编码难题的实战案例:
场景:某公司开发一款在线教育平台,需要实现视频播放、直播、互动等功能。
传统编码方式:开发人员需要从头开始编写每个功能模块的代码,工作量巨大,且难以保证代码质量。
RSC编码解决方案:
- 资源共享:利用开源库和框架,如HLS、WebRTC等,实现视频播放和直播功能。
- 模块化:将平台功能分解为多个模块,如用户管理、课程管理、直播管理等。
- 可复用性:将通用功能(如用户登录、注册等)封装成模块,供其他模块复用。
- 灵活性:根据项目需求,选择合适的编程语言和框架进行开发。
通过RSC编码,该在线教育平台在短时间内顺利上线,且代码质量较高,满足了用户需求。
总结
RSC编码作为一种新兴的编码技术,正逐渐改变着软件开发的方式。它通过资源共享、模块化、可复用性和灵活性等特点,让软件开发更高效,轻松解决编码难题。在未来的软件开发中,RSC编码有望成为主流的编码方式。